- Abstract:
- Abstract: The Artisanal and Small-scale Mining (ASM) sector is a source of livelihood for many people that cannot get white-collar jobs. However, the sector has a plethora of challenges that threaten its economic stability and/or growth. These need to be mitigated or ameliorated through strategic policy response. To attain this, the criticality levels of challenges should be quantitatively assessed based on their intensity and ability to influence or cause other challenges. Currently, no quantitative framework has been developed for this undertaking. Therefore, in this paper, a DEMATEL based framework integrating an expert questionnaire survey, intensity-influence scoring matrix, and sensitivity analysis has been proposed. The framework identifies and ranks critical challenges to prioritize policy response. To illustrate its practical application, it was applied in the assessment of challenges in Zambia's artisanal and small-scale manganese mining sector. Results show that the number of highly, mildly, and tolerably critical challenges are three, four, and one, respectively. Highly, mildly, and tolerably critical challenges are those having a criticality rating of (12–25), (6–10), and (1–5), respectively. The proposed framework has the potential to be used by governments to aid the systematic and strategic formulation of policies that can mitigate critical causal challenges to attain economic stability and/or growth of the ASM sector.
